## Build Provenance: Zero-Downtime Schema Migrations

The Larkfield team now stamps every migration bundle with provenance metadata before it ships to the Quillbase fleet. Expand-contract migrations run in two tracked phases, so the weekly sync can confirm which build applied which phase. Rollbacks reference the same record. Verification requires matching the deployed artifact against the token recorded below.

pipeline stamp: htk31_f769b577b3028a4e9958e5bb8d1259a

Subject: Payslips — Netherfold depot

Dispatch,

Netherfold depot still has no working printer. Payroll has printed the month's payslips here instead. Thirty-one sealed envelopes, one box, marked PAYROLL — NETHERFOLD. Box is with me at the warehouse office until collected.

Needs to go out on tomorrow's first run. Do not leave at the gatehouse. Do not split the box. Recipient signs on arrival, standard form.

These are confidential wage documents, so the courier hand-over must follow the instruction given below.

dispatch memo: the lamwyn fenwyn courier leaves the wenir ledger at gate 7175 under passcode 822969

During the Larkspur consent banner rollout, some operator accounts were locked by the new session policy. Release manager: verify the affected account predates the rollout cutoff, confirm the user's region flag matches the banner cohort, then initiate recovery from the Bramblewick admin console. Do not reset sessions in bulk; handle each account individually to preserve consent audit trails. When the console prompts for authorization, enter the recovery passphrase that appears below.

unlock words, kagef-taduf: fenir-quenix-norwyn-sorvan-gormir-gorir-fraok

## Nightly backfill scheduler

This PR adds a scheduler for nightly data backfills in the Corvasse pipeline, replacing the ad-hoc scripts Team Heronwood ran by hand. Backfills are declared as dated ranges; the scheduler splits them into day-sized chunks, runs them oldest-first, and checkpoints after each chunk so restarts resume cleanly. Failures quarantine the chunk rather than halting the queue. Concurrency is capped to avoid starving the daily jobs on the same warehouse. Defaults were picked from two weeks of staging runs and are shown here.

constants for bawif-kawif:
QUOTAS = {
    "ulaael": 5,
    "holael": 10,
}